Agni Parthene (Monks Of Simonopetra)
The "Agni Parthene" is a non-liturgical Orthodox hymn, written by Saint Nektarios of Aegina. According to Tradition, the melody was composed by the angels themselves.
This song was originally written in Greek, and was translated into many languages, including Church Slavonic, English, Serbian and Arabic.
